Use an equation to find the value of k so that the line that passes through (-2,k) and (2,0) has a slope of m=-1
Dima020 [189]

Answer:

The value of k is 4.

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the missing coordinate, we can use the slope equation and plug in all known values.

m(slope) =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1)

-1 = (k - 0)/(-2 - 2)

-1 = k/-4

Now we can solve using cross multiplication.

-1 = k/-4

k*1 = -1*-4

k = 4
